The Kia Forum in Inglewood is one of those legendary spots that feels like stepping into music history itself. You’ve probably seen it in movies that celebrate the golden era of rock and roll or its role in shaping cultural milestones. It’s been officially recognized as a historic landmark, which just adds to its charm. This place isn’t just about big concerts; it’s a community hub that often works with local schools and organizations, making it feel more like a neighborhood gathering than just a concert hall. Last year’s big highlight was hosting the 2026 iHeartRadio Music Awards, but honestly, every show here feels special, whether it’s a legendary band in town or a rising star. The venue’s got reserved sections for those who want to guarantee a good spot, and their Lounge Box seating offers a laid-back vibe with tasty bites and drinks. If you’re coming from downtown LA, plan for about a 20 to 30-minute drive, but trust me, it’s worth it for the experience.
